description Product Description

This compound is primarily utilized in pharmaceutical research and development as a key intermediate in the synthesis of various biologically active molecules. Its structure, featuring a piperazine ring and a chloropyrazin-2-yl moiety, makes it valuable for designing compounds targeting central nervous system disorders, particularly those involving dopamine and serotonin receptors. It is often employed in the creation of potential therapeutic agents for conditions like schizophrenia, depression, and anxiety. Additionally, its reactive sites allow for further functionalization, enabling the development of diverse chemical libraries for drug discovery and optimization.
